Abstract

This short clinical article provides general dental practitioners GDPs with an overview of some the clinical and planning challenges that frequently arise in the provision of clear aligner treatment. The article provides an overview of the benefits of a new way of working, in which the GDP is supported and mentored through the key stages of treatment offering the following advantages: better case selection; more predictable treatment plans and gaining valid consent. All of which aim to optimise the GDP and more importantly patient experience and outcome.
